Enhance the security of your sensitive data on USB drives with Rohos Mini Drive, an effective encryption tool designed to keep your portable information safe from unauthorized access.

Key Features and Functionality

Rohos Mini Drive stands out as a resourceful application tailored to secure the data on your USB storage devices. By creating a secure, encrypted partition on the drive, the application ensures that your sensitive files remain confidential, even if the USB drive falls into the wrong hands. Users are allowed to select from leading encryption algorithms, including Blowfish and the robust 256-bit AES, for robust protection tailored to their security preference.

Ease of use is a defining feature of Rohos Mini Drive. Once you insert your USB drive, a few simple steps will guide you through setting a password and choosing the desired file system — be it FAT, FAT32, or NTFS. The straightforward interface makes encryption accessible to everyone, regardless of their technical expertise.

A distinguishing aspect of Rohos Mini Drive is its ability to create a secure partition while retaining a public space on the USB drive. This unique feature enables users to save unencrypted files alongside the protected ones, thereby optimizing the utility of the storage device without compromising security.

Performance and Accessibility

Performance-wise, Rohos Mini Drive performs its encryption tasks efficiently without significant delays, preventing disruptions to workflow. The utility provides an autonomous workspace that can be accessed through a discreet drive label in 'My Computer,' making it convenient to manage your encrypted data.

Users should note, however, that there have been some inconsistencies when trying to access the encrypted drive via shortcuts created on the desktop. These glitches, while minor, can be circumvented by accessing the drive directly from 'My Computer,' where the application works flawlessly.

An added benefit for enhancing concealment is the newly included “Hide folder” option, which furthers the privacy aspect by allowing users to hide specific folders within the encrypted space.
